Defiant PhR
Defiant PhR is a determinate hybrid slicer with red fruit. It ripens in about 65 days.

Flavor
Described in catalogs as having great flavor for a disease-resistant slicer, smooth and medium-firm with good texture. This is the recurring catalog and grower description, not a measured claim.
Origin
An F1 hybrid bred by Johnny's Selected Seeds in collaboration with North Carolina State University, traditionally bred to inherit the Ph-2 and Ph-3 major genes for late blight resistance.
What it does well
- High resistance to late blight plus intermediate resistance to early blight
- Early and high yielding on widely adaptable medium-sized plants
- Determinate habit needs little or no pruning or support
- Also carries high resistance to Fusarium wilt and Verticillium wilt
Where it frustrates
- An F1 hybrid, so seed cannot be saved true
- Bred for disease resistance and earliness, so flavor is good rather than exceptional
Growing it
- Determinate bush. It sets most of its crop in one concentrated flush, which suits batch cooking and canning, and needs only light support.
- Ripens early, under about 70 days, one of the safer picks where the summer is short.
- Generally forgiving and beginner-friendly to grow.
- One of our picks for the cold, short-season gardens of New England.
Disease resistance
Late blight resistance is high; early blight resistance is intermediate.
Why no hardiness zone?
Tomatoes are warm-season annuals, so variety choice comes down to days to maturity and your local frost dates.
